Kasmarra Population - Rajnandgaon, Chhattisgarh
Kasmarra is a medium size village located in Chhuikhadan Tehsil of Rajnandgaon district, Chhattisgarh with total 137 families residing. The Kasmarra village has population of 613 of which 308 are males while 305 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kasmarra village population of children with age 0-6 is 113 which makes up 18.43 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kasmarra village is 990 which is lower than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Kasmarra as per census is 948, lower than Chhattisgarh average of 969.
Kasmarra village has lower liter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kasmarra village was 61.00 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Kasmarra Male literacy stands at 72.40 % while female literacy rate was 49.60 %.

Kasmarra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 137 | - | - |
Population | 613 | 308 | 305 |
Child (0-6) | 113 | 58 | 55 |
Schedule Caste | 63 | 28 | 35 |
Schedule Tribe | 105 | 59 | 46 |
Literacy | 61.00 % | 72.40 % | 49.60 % |
Total Workers | 400 | 195 | 205 |
Main Worker | 87 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 313 | 133 | 180 |
